We have the following function:
 P (m) = m / 6 + 9
 Clearing m we have:
 m = 6 * (p-9)
 m= 6*p - 6*9
 Rewriting:
 m (p) = 6p-54
 Answer:
 The inverse function for this case is given by:
 m (p) = 6p-54
 option A
